Influence Mechanism Of Nano Titanium Dioxide On The Toxicity Effects Of Chinese Cabbage Under Cadmium Stress

Nano titanium dioxide?TiO2?is one of the most widely used nanomaterials,which can enter into farmland ecological environment through several avenues such as sewage irrigation,waste landfill,fertilizing,and sludge application to farmland soils,these nanomaterials may alter the ecotoxicity of co-existing contaminants,such as Cd.As one of the most widely eaten and cultivated green leafy vegetables,Chinese cabbage is easy to absorb Cd from the soil and transfer it to edible parts.However,the influence of nano TiO2 on the absorption,accumulation and toxicity of Cd in Chinese cabbage are still not fully understood.Therefore,this study investigated the absorption and transport of nano TiO2 and Cd in Chinese cabbage?Brassica rapa var.glabra?and their joint toxicity through hydroponic experiments.The influence mechanism of nano TiO2 on the toxic effect of Chinese cabbage under Cd stress was further discussed.The results showed that:?1?Nano TiO2 can penetrate into the roots through the symplast pathway and accumulation,and transported upward to the blade;Nano TiO2 was mainly distributed in the form of particle aggregates in the cell walls,cytoplasm,vacuoles and chloroplasts of the root and leaf cells of Chinese cabbage.?2?The root morphology of Chinese cabbage seedlings was abnormal,the root became shorter and thicker,the number of root tips and the root surface area were decreased significantly under the treatment of nano TiO2,which lead to the significant decrease on the biomass of Chinese cabbage.The chloroplast structure was not significantly damaged under nano TiO2 stress.When the treatment concentration of nano TiO2 was 50 mg·L-1,the chlorophyll content significantly increased,promoting the photosynthesis of Chinese cabbage.Nano TiO2 induced the production of ROS and activated the antioxidant of SOD?CAT and POD and alleviated the damage of ROS on cell membrane.?3?When the concentration of Cd was 1 mg·L-1 and 10 mg·L-1,the bioaccumulation of Cd in Chinese cabbage was increased with the increase of nano TiO2 concentration.Compared to Cd treatment alone,the content of Cd in the roots of Chinese cabbage significantly increased by 44.13%and 61.43%?P<0.05?,when coexisting with nano TiO2 at 20 mg·L-1 concentration.At lower Cd concentration(1 mg·L-1),nano TiO2 showed a significant promoting effect on SOD and POD activity in leaf tissues of Chinese cabbage,but had no significant effect on fresh weight,chlorophyll content and oxidative damage index of root system.At higher Cd concentration(10mg·L-1),the activities of SOD,POD and CAT in leaves and root tissues of Chinese cabbage were significantly reduced when nano TiO2 was 20 mg·L-1,the cellular structure was severely damaged and the plant biomass and chlorophyll content of Chinese cabbage seedlings were significantly reduced.Therefore,nano TiO2 increased the toxicity of Cd to Chinese cabbage.The results of the study revealed the mechanism of the biotoxic effect of Nano-TiO2 on Cd,that is,nano-TiO2,as the carrier of Cd,significantly promoted the accumulation of Cd in Chinese cabbage,induced membrane lipid peroxidation,destroyed the antioxidant defense system and cell ultrastructure of Chinese cabbage,and led to oxidative damage.Therefore,although the toxicity of nano-TiO2 is relatively low,there is a risk of increasing the toxicity of coexisting pollutants to plants when coexisting with other pollutants.It can provide scientific basis for the country to establish the safety assessment and prevention system of nano materials,and provide risk prediction direction for ensuring the national food security and the healthy development of modern agricultural ecosystem.
